In-Depth Analysis
Overview
2026-ao.shop presents itself as the official online store for the Australian Open. The website's title and description both explicitly state this purpose. It offers login and payment functionalities, suggesting e-commerce capabilities.
Security Assessment
The website utilizes a valid SSL certificate issued by Google Trust Services, indicating encrypted communication. The certificate's expiration date in 2026 is a positive sign. Furthermore, Google Safe Browsing reports a clean status, a strong positive signal.
Trust Level
The FlareScore of 66/100 is a warning sign, indicating a moderate level of risk. While the SSL certificate and clean Google Safe Browsing status are reassuring, the FlareScore suggests potential areas of concern. The fact that the website is hosted in Canada despite claiming to be the Australian Open Official Online Shop is a negative signal.
